Description
The vulnerability allows a remote #AU# to read and manipulate data.
The (1) do_send and (2) do_recv functions in io.c in libvchan in Xen 4.2.x, 4.3.x, and 4.4-RC series allows local guests to cause a denial of service or possibly gain privileges via crafted xenstore ring indexes, which triggers a "read or write past the end of the ring."
Mitigation
Install update from vendor's website.
Vulnerable software versions
Xen: 4.2.0 - 4.4.0
